How much do remote on call cyber security analyst j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 7, 2026, the average yearly pay for remote on call cyber security analyst in the United States is $99,400.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$79,500.00 and $115,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a remote on call cyber security analyst?

Remote On Call Cyber Security Analysts are professionals who monitor, detect, and respond to cybersecurity threats and incidents outside of regular business hours, often working from remote locations. Their primary responsibility is to ensure the security of an organization’s digital assets by quickly addressing any security breaches, vulnerabilities, or suspicious activities as they arise. These analysts use specialized tools to analyze alerts, investigate potential threats, and coordinate incident response, all while being available on an on-call basis, including nights, weekends, and holidays. The remote aspect allows them to work from anywhere with secure internet access, providing flexible coverage for organizations that need round-the-clock protection.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ote on call cyber security analyst?

To thrive as a Remote On Call Cyber Security Analyst, you need a strong understanding of network security, incident response, and risk assessment, typically backed by a degree in cybersecurity or related field and relevant certifications like CompTIA Security+ or CISSP. Familiarity with SIEM tools, intrusion detection/prevention systems (IDS/IPS), and remote monitoring platforms is essential for effective threat analysis and response. Outstanding problem-solving abilities, attention to detail, and strong communication skills enable you to triage incidents and coordinate with teams under pressure. These competencies are crucial for protecting organizational assets and ensuring rapid, effective responses to emerging cyber threats in a dynamic remote environment.

What are some common challenges faced by remote on call cyber security analysts, and how can they be managed?

Remote On Call Cyber Security Analysts often encounter challenges such as responding quickly to incidents across different time zones and maintaining effective communication with distributed teams. Managing alert fatigue from monitoring multiple systems is also common. To succeed, it's important to establish clear escalation procedures, use robust collaboration tools, and schedule regular check-ins with team members. Continuous learning and staying updated on the latest cybersecurity threats also help in effectively handling incidents and reducing response times.
